What Is Hybrid Satellite Connectivity?

Hybrid satellite connectivity combines satellite and terrestrial communications into a single managed network, allowing organizations to use the most appropriate connection based on location, application requirements, network conditions, and business priorities.

Why Hybrid Connectivity Is Complex

Performance and Coverage Vary

No single network performs best in every environment. LEO and GEO satellites offer different advantages, while fiber, LTE, and 5G each have unique strengths and limitations depending on location, coverage, and application requirements.

Organizations operating across vessels, remote sites, construction projects, or distributed facilities must continuously adapt to changing network conditions. Maintaining consistent performance requires intelligent traffic management that automatically routes applications across the most appropriate connection.

Operational Complexity Increases

As organizations expand, they often add new providers to meet evolving connectivity needs. While this improves coverage, it also introduces operational complexity.

Common challenges include:

  • Multiple provider contracts
  • Separate monitoring platforms
  • Different service level agreements
  • Independent support organizations
  • Limited visibility across the network

Without centralized management, troubleshooting becomes more difficult and operational overhead increases.

Security Must Extend Across Every Network

Hybrid connectivity expands the number of pathways through which data travels.

Organizations must apply consistent security policies across satellite, terrestrial, cloud, and private networks while maintaining visibility into every connection. Without centralized governance, security becomes more difficult to manage and operational risk increases.
